Thumbnail Queue (Snapgrove)

Welcome! The thumbnail generation queue chews through uploads in batches of fifty. If it backs up, it's almost always a stuck worker holding a lease — just restart the pool and the lease expires. Dead-letter items older than a week can be purged safely. Questions about weird image formats should go to the media team.

escalation mailbox, hadug-bajog: sormir@norvalabs.internal

Handover — Crashlog pipeline (Fenwick app)

The ingest workers on the Tallowmere cluster are stable again after Tuesday's backlog. Dedupe is running, symbolication queue is under two minutes. One open item: the retention job needs its vault re-sealed after the restart, and it will prompt for the recovery passphrase on first run. Priya rotated it yesterday. If you get paged, unseal with the passphrase that follows below.

unlock words, tawif-tahop: oliys-ulawyn-tamdor-lamys-casox-jormir-fraius-kasath-ulador-ulamir-holir-sorys-holeth

**POST /v2/scale**

The PortionPal scaling endpoint takes a recipe payload and a `targetServings` integer, then returns ingredient quantities rounded to sensible kitchen units (nobody wants 0.37 eggs). Fractional results snap to the nearest eighth unless you pass `precise: true`. Note the reviewer-facing quirk: unit conversions happen *before* scaling, so keep that ordering when you touch the pipeline. Rate limits are generous on the Brambleton staging cluster. For smoke-testing against staging, authenticate your requests with this token.

portal login ticket: eyJhbGciOiJIUzI1NiIsInR5cCI6IkpXVCJ9.eyJzdWIiOiIwEOsktwVNwIn0.-UJU3fdyyCgG

- [ ] Step 7: Archive cold storage buckets (Glacierline tier). Confirm both ceremony witnesses are present, verify bucket manifests match the Oxbow ledger, then seal the archive key shares. Plugin authors may observe but not handle shares. Once sealed, the archive index itself is encrypted and can only be reopened with the passphrase below.

vault phrase of badup-hahig = tamael-aldael-kelmir-istael-fenok-istwyn-tamius-jorath-oliion